Expo a must for parents and traders

LOCAL retailers and service providers are being encouraged to take part in the upcoming Casey Pregnancy and Early Years expo.
Casey mayor Janet Halsall said the Casey Pregnancy and Early Years Expo would be a great day for parents and parents-to-be to come along and find parenting information and product advice located in their local community.
“It is also a wonderful opportunity for retailers and service providers in the prenatal and early years’ industry to network, and perhaps strike-up some potential business partnerships,” she said.
A limited number of exhibition spaces are still available for businesses and services located in Casey.
For more information call 9705 5200 or visit www.casey.vic.gov.au. Forms must be received by Friday 7 March 2008.
The 2008 Casey Pregnancy and Early Years Expo will be held between 10am and 4pm on Saturday 17 May 2008 at the Balla Balla Centre in Cranbourne East.
